How much does it cost to rent an apartment in East Flat Rock?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
East Flat Rock Studio Apartments | $1,482 | $1,055 | $3,429 |
East Flat Rock 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,647 | $919 | $4,406 |
East Flat Rock 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,963 | $368 | $5,360 |
East Flat Rock 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,543 | $1,695 | $8,052 |
East Flat Rock 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,783 | $2,750 | $2,850 |

Frequently Asked Questions about East Flat Rock Apartments with Swimming Pool
How much is the average rent for East Flat Rock Apartments with Swimming Pool?
The average rent for a Apartment in East Flat Rock with Swimming Pool is $2,131.
What is the largest East Flat Rock Apartment for rent with Swimming Pool?
Today's Apartment with Swimming Pool and the most square footage in East Flat Rock is a 1,760 square feet unit starting from $1,522 at Aventine Asheville.
What is the average size for East Flat Rock Apartments for rent with Swimming Pool?
The average size for a rental with Swimming Pool in East Flat Rock is currently at 695 sq ft.
